Here's a picture of the one I built for my old truck. It was 2.5" tubes and 1/4" plate. I used the stock holes and one of the front hitch bolts to secure it, so it had 3 bolts per side.
I used a ramsey winch plate and mount it too my 4" tube bumber by making brackets that look like muffler clamps. Took some 3" by 6" square channel and cutting and grinding to fit then welding it on. (no u-bolts) This has held up real good. RKD.
